WebWater flow monitoring or flow based water leak detection and automatic shut-off systems work by monitoring both the volume and amount of time water is moving through pipes. They use a flow meter and compare water volumes against set thresholds. When abnormal flow is detected, usually due to a burst or faulty pipe, the valve automatically closes ... WebApr 30, 2024 · The two speeds are related as. (5.2.3) v ¯ t = v ¯ s + σ s 2 v ¯ s. The time mean speed higher than the space mean speed, but the differences vary with the amount of variability within the speed of vehices.
